A Comprehensive Guide to Obtaining a Driving License
Obtaining a driving license is a vital step towards getting independence and improving movement. This document permits a specific to lawfully operate a motor lorry on public roadways. While the process differs based upon the country or area, certain basic steps stay consistent. This short article aims to offer a useful overview of the driving license acquisition process, crucial factors to consider, and answers to frequently asked concerns.
Steps to Obtain a Driving License
Acquiring a driving license generally follows a methodical process. Below are the common steps involved:
1. Comprehend the Requirements
Before the application process starts, it is important to familiarize oneself with the requirements. They may vary by location, but typical prerequisites typically include:
Age Requirement: The minimum age to get a student's permit or a complete driving license differs by state or country, normally ranging from 16 to 18 years.
Documents: Prepare necessary documents such as:
Proof of identity (e.g., birth certificate or passport)
Social Security number (in the U.S.)
Proof of residency
Learner's Permit: Many areas need brand-new chauffeurs to very first get a learner's permit, permitting them to practice driving under particular conditions.
2. Take a Driver Education Course
Lots of nations or states mandate the completion of a chauffeur's education course. These courses cover essential subjects, including traffic laws, safe driving practices, and protective driving techniques. Finishing this course can typically lead to a reduction in insurance coverage expenses and often speed up the licensing process.
